Johnsonville remembers more than 48,000 pounds of frozen pork patties due to pollution concerns




Johnsonville remembers more than 48,000 pounds of his frozen bacon and cheddar ground pork patties, according to the US Department of Agriculture.

USDA received at least three complaints that the pork was potentially contaminated with black rubber.

There are no reports of diseases or injuries caused by the products.

The recall is limited to 24 oz. book packages by Johnsonville Cheddar Cheese & Bacon Grillers with one of three Best Flavor By dates and an EST number:

  • 07/24/201[ads1]9 and an EST 34225
    08/13/2019 and one EST 34225
    08/14/2019 and an EST 34225

The products were distributed to 31 states, according to a statement posted on the sausage firm's website. No other Johnsonville products are affected by this recall.
